Need emergency contraception? Just text
Oops, I did it again
Can't remember what or who you did last night? Send a text to 62233 and it will respond with the location of the nearest stockist of Levonelle, the emergency contraceptive pill. The service is being run by Incentivated for Schering Health Care. It links to the mobile phone operator to work out roughly where you are, and will …

BlackBerry plugs in to Visual Studio
Extensions
With as many.NET developers as there are BlackBerry users, it’s about time Research in Motion provided some Visual Studio development tools. There's not too long to wait, as RIM used its Wireless Enterprise Symposium this week to unveil its first Visual Studio plug-in. Don't be confused - this isn't a .NET solution, and RIM …
